--- Comment #40 from Thorsten Behrens (CIB)  ---
I wonder how much of this is a bug, vs. a user experience deficiency.

Technically, LibreOffice _could_ embed the entire font, for those that don't
prohibit that in the font flags (N.B. most Windows fonts do _not_ permit that).
The drawback is a significant increase in PDF size, especially for short 1-2
page forms (fonts with good unicode coverage are easily 2-10MB in size).

For fonts where LibreOffice cannot embed more than a subset, several options
come to mind:
* leave things as they are, and perhaps issue a warning during export
(suggesting users to pick one of the 12 standard PDF fonts)
* try to be smart & embed a subset that matches the language selected at the
text at hand
* always fallback to Helvetia (or something) for PDF forms

I think you have no issue because your Forms in that PDF use "Helvetica",
that's one of the 14 standard fonts, and all readers have a copy of this font
locally.

So, in my opinion, this does not show this is a regression. If you had a PDF
form created with an old version of Libre/OpenOffice with a non-standard font
for input fields embedded, then we would have a regression.

--- Comment #35 from Gellért Gyuris  ---
Workaround... add this script to exported PDF as a top-level document
JavaScript:

function updateFields() {
  for ( var fieldNumber = 0; fieldNumber < this.numFields; fieldNumber++) {
getField(getNthFieldName(fieldNumber)).textFont = font.Helv;
  }
}
updateFields();

Other fonts:
Times-Roman   = font.Times
Times-Bold= font.TimesB
Times-Italic  = font.TimesI
Times-BoldItalic  = font.TimesBI
Helvetica = font.Helv
Helvetica-Bold= font.HelvB
Helvetica-Oblique = font.HelvI
Helvetica-BoldOblique = font.HelvBI
Courier   = font.Cour
Courier-Bold  = font.CourB
Courier-Oblique   = font.CourI
Courier-BoldOblique   = font.CourBI
Symbol= font.Symbol
ZapfDingbats  = font.ZapfD

--- Comment #3 from Oho daniel.nede...@holotron.ro ---
The standard fonts from the Embed standard fonts choice, are the 14
standard Postscript fonts, according to LibreOffice Help.

The choice Embed standard fonts would lead to the embedding of all your
document fonts if and only if you are using only [some of] these fonts as fonts
in your documents.
